Centenary Bank Named Best Digital Brand in Uganda

Centenary Bank has won the top Digital Impact Awards Africa (DIAA) accolades for its innovative digital products and approach to digital communication to its customers.

The bank won three awards including; Digital Brand of the Year, Best Digital Customer Experience by Bank and Best Mobile Banking.

DIAA is a platform that promotes Digital inclusion, financial inclusion and Cybersecurity under the theme ‘Maximizing the Digital Dividend.’

The awards, an initiative of HiPipo Limited and Cyberplc aim at recognizing and appreciating different organizations that are spearheading the use of digital mediums.

Innocent Kawooya, the CEO, HiPipo said that there are three key components for the success of a digital financial services ecosystem: a digital transactional platform, retail agent or distribution chain, and the use by customers and agents of a device – most commonly a mobile phone to transact via the platform.

“Centenary Bank has walked this journey delivering great mobile banking, innovative financial inclusion solutions coming with great digital customer experience and we congratulate them,” he said.

Allen Ayebare, the bank’s Chief Manager Corporate Affairs and Communication noted that the awards demonstrate the bank’s resolve to promote digital inclusion and financial inclusion, through innovative, affordable and convenient digital products and customer engagements.

“We wish to thank HiPipo, Cyberplc for organizing the awards and the public that voted us the best digital brand for the year 2018. We commit to continue the digital innovation and transformation journey as we deepen financial inclusion in Uganda to empower more people financially.”

Centenary Bank embarked on its digital revolution in 2003 when it acquired its first Automated Teller Machine (ATM).

Today, it has 176 ATMs, 64 point of sale machines and a mobile phone banking platform dubbed ‘CenteMobile.’ This year, the bank has introduced two new digital services; the CenteVisa debit card and the CenteMobile loans, to deepen financial inclusion.

On social media, the bank commands a following of over 365,418 people on Facebook, 14,700 followers on Twitter, 283 subscribers on YouTube and the numbers are still growing.

Centenary Bank has participated in the DIAA previously, receiving awards of excellence for its outstanding services in 2015 and 2016.
